Waconia Brewing Company is family-owned and operated and is celebrating its 10-year anniversary later this year. As their motto suggests, approachable beers by approachable people, this brewery is all about customer service and a family-friendly atmosphere. The DeLange family likes to make sure their customers never feel intimidated or overwhelmed by their beer. The staff prides themselves on being knowledgeable and welcoming. There is no dumb question when someone sits down and wants to know more about craft beer. Their goal is to educate and help the patron find their favorite flavor.
WBC’s taproom is home to five flagship beers that have been brewing since the beginning and are always in season. They also rotate 7-10 seasonal brews that complement the calendar. Not into beer? Try their seltzer or a refreshing seltzer slushy for those warmer days.
If you’ve ever visited their space, you’re familiar with their patio during warmer weather and their cozy fireplace for cooler temps. Schram Haus Brewery is the result of a successful hobby that originally started at Schram Vineyards. As popular as their wines, the craft brews proved to be standalone champions, and in 2019, they moved into their own establishment in downtown Chaska. This brewery sits on three acres overlooking the Minnesota River Valley. The bluffs create a beautiful backdrop for an outdoor space that hosts two large events each year. You may have just visited in April for their annual GOAT FEST, or you might be familiar with OKTOBIERFEST, held each year in September. If not, add them to your list!
One of the most unique aspects of this brewery is its accessibility to a winery. The connection to their original vineyard home allows head brewmaster Brian VanHout the opportunity to play with equipment and barrels to create small batches with specialty flavors. Think hybrid recipes that combine wine with beer, such as their exclusive rosé-champagne mixed with a lager that’s released on New Year’s.

There is no shortage of fun or flavor. Schram Haus offers a selection of brews and seltzers that you just won’t find anywhere else. From light to hoppy to dark and fruity. They harvest locally sourced ingredients like plums from abandoned fruit trees in the area, even dandelions in a field nearby!
ENKI Brewery began in what was once the Victoria Creamery. However, it didn’t take long until they outgrew that space and moved just down the street, where they now sit near the shores of Stieger Lake. It’s a renovated warehouse that provides an open atmosphere with an intimate industrial feel. It’s the perfect place for trivia, date night, or a group just looking to unwind from a long day. Its ownership was created out of a passion for the pint and its people. They aim to make good beer and great friends.
ENKI’s offerings are always changing, and their taproom is a spectrum of brews, including light and golden, IPA’s, sours, wheat ale, pilsner, and stout. And if you have an affection for coffee, you might love their popular Mocha Porter, created with cold-press coffee.
